site stats

Hash memory allocation

WebSep 4, 2024 · If you are running a single server with 4GB of RAM from out of your home you'll probably need a different answer than if you have a pool of 10 machines each with 64GB of RAM dedicated to password hashing. Also, the expected number of users you have may play a part as well. – Ella Rose Sep 4, 2024 at 15:06 2 Web1 million keys - Hash value, representing an object with 5 fields, use ~ 160 MB of memory. 64-bit has more memory available as compared to a 32-bit machine. But if you are sure …

Sort-Based and Hash-Based Memory-Constrained Operators

WebMemory allocation problem 2 ; c++ Hash table using linked list 4 ; Not what you need? Reach out to all the awesome people in our software development community by starting your own topic. We equally welcome both specific questions as well as open-ended discussions. Start New Topic. WebMar 17, 2024 · While the number of probes can be as big as 4 sometimes, it can be as low as 1 many times as well. So it is not surprising the expected number of probes can be as low as 2.. To be exact and rigorous, the phrase "expected number" as in "the expected number of probes" and "the maximum expected number of probes" has a specific meaning … bully wear purple https://aaph-locations.com

The Return of RESERVED_MEMORY_ALLOCATION_EXT

WebTo see the difference in memory consumption between the operators, you can run a query and then view the query profile in the Drill Web UI. Optionally, you can disable the Hash … http://www.idryman.org/blog/2024/05/03/writing-a-damn-fast-hash-table-with-tiny-memory-footprints/ WebMemory Allocation. To estimate the memory requirement, use the “Estimate Memory and Storage Requirements” tool. If the Memory Allocated is not enough and when the memory is fully used, the new data cannot insert new hash into hash DB. So, any data that are backed up after that cannot be Deduplicated, causing the Dedupe ratio to go down. bully wear sweatshirts

How much memory is required to calculate deduplication

Category:Memory Optimization for Redis Redis Documentation Center

Tags:Hash memory allocation

Hash memory allocation

password hashing - Argon2 - memory setting - lower bound ...

WebApr 14, 2024 · Redis also uses such as memory allocation optimization, thread-safe data structures, and caching. Redis leverages low-level data structures like Linked List, Skip List, and Hash Table to deliver ... WebThis data structure provides several services that increase performance, such as memory alignment of objects, lockless access to objects, NUMA awareness, bulk get/put and per-lcore cache. The rte_malloc () function uses a similar concept to mempools. 62.1.3. Concurrent Access to the Same Memory Area

Hash memory allocation

Did you know?

WebThe only work, to our knowledge, that directly handles memory allocation among concurrently executing hash-join queries is [Corn89, Yu93]. The authors introduce the concepts ofmemory consumption and return on consumption which are used to study the overall reduction in response times due to additional memory allocation. A heuristic … WebJul 29, 2016 · I was inspired by this topic: Performance and Memory allocation comparision between List and Set to actually run some tests and measure the performance difference …

Web22 hours ago · polars - memory allocation of N bytes failed. Trying to execute a statement on a file of 30 Gbs containing 26 million records with 33 columns. When we execute on a sample with 10,000 rows, works without any errors. problem exists on the full file. Noticed that I was able to execute the code in jupyter, however this fails when running from VS ... WebPractice working with linked lists and dynamic memory allocation by implementing a hash table in C. Learn how to declare and use function pointers in C. An Introduction to Hash Tables A hash table is an efficient data structure for maintaining a collection of key -to- value mappings.

WebSeveral memory allocation and scheduling schemes are presented and their performance is compared using a detailed simulation study. The results demonstrate the inadequacies … WebSwitch to 32-bits. Redis gives you these statistics for a 64-bit machine. An empty instance uses ~ 3MB of memory. 1 million small keys - String Value pairs use ~ 85MB of memory. 1 million keys - Hash value, representing an object with 5 fields, use ~ 160 MB of memory. 64-bit has more memory available as compared to a 32-bit machine.

WebApr 25, 2024 · Two common strategies for hash table memory layouts are indirect (typically with a pointer stored in the main array) and direct (with the memory of the keys and …

WebDec 27, 2024 · Over-allocation is implemented in mutable data structures for reducing the number of re-allocations and for avoiding collisions in hash tables. sys.getsizeof counts … halas structuresWebApr 21, 2024 · You'd calculate the amount of memory needed for your implementation of a hash table, plus the collection of buckets, plus the worst case for memory for the … halaster’s blast scepterWebHashes, Lists, Sets composed of just integers, and Sorted Sets, when smaller than a given number of elements, and up to a maximum element size, are encoded in a very memory-efficient way that uses up to 10 times less memory (with 5 times less memory used being the average saving). halass sportWebJul 1, 2024 · This is the third article in a series about how memory management works in the Data Plane Development Kit (DPDK). The first article in the series described general concepts that lie at the foundation of DPDK. halaster\u0027s lost apprenticeWebhash = hashfunc (key) index = hash % array_size So in my example, the indices would be: 0 % 3 = 0 10 % 3 = 1 20 % 3 = 2 This gets rid of the huge gaps that I mentioned before. Even with this modulo scheme, there's problems when you add more objects to the hash … bully wear tennesseeWebPolicy question: should JVM ask OS for more memory and if so, how much? General trade-o between amount of memory JVM is willing to use and achievable throughput Traditional rule of thumb: budget 1:5 { 2:5 the size of the live heap to stay within acceptable performance overhead compared to explicit allocation; but appears to be too optimistic halas receptekWebSep 4, 2024 · If you are running a single server with 4GB of RAM from out of your home you'll probably need a different answer than if you have a pool of 10 machines each with … halaster\\u0027s apprentices